Body

Origins and Family

John Harrison Aylmer was born on +1813-01-24T00:00:00Z[2]. His father was Arthur Aylmer[5]. His mother was Anne Harrison[6].

Career and Affiliations

John Harrison Aylmer held the position of High Sheriff of Durham[10].

Personal Life

John Harrison Aylmer was married to Rosanna Louisa Coghill[7]. Children include Arthur Fitzgerald Harrison Aylmer[8], 1850–1868[22] and Gerald Percy Vivian Aylmer[9], a big game hunter[23], 1856–1936[24].

Death and Burial

John Harrison Aylmer died on +1868-08-20T00:00:00Z[3]. The cause of death was train wreck[13]. He is buried at St Michael's Church, Abergele[4].
